oscarsear Posted October 23, 2005 Share Posted October 23, 2005 One of the major ways people cut themselves is wrestling with a dull knife..and it slips and YIKES. The way to keep those knives razor sharp is to whet them after each and every use. Don't wait until they're dull and then try to Daniel Boone sharpen them (unless you really know how to). It won't work to the degree you want or need. Even those fancy brand knives need this treatment to retain their killer edges!!![6] Now I'm wandering in this instance IF there's not more to it.
